關於存儲單位的換算,大家一般會想到下面的換算方法。
1GB=1024MB
1MB=1024KB
1kb=1024字節
但實際生活中,這種換算方法並不准確。
例如在商家生產銷售的硬盤, U盤中就不是這樣換算的。
商家眼中的換算方法是這樣的:
1GB=1000MB
1MB=1000KB
1kb=1000字節
因此我們常常會發現買回來的硬盤沒有商家的所宣傳那么大。
比如1T的硬盤,按我們的想法應該是1024GB大小。
但實際只有930GB左右大小。
1T的硬盤在商家眼中的大小是 1000 000 000 000 Byte
我們可以換算一下:1000 000 000 000 / 1024/1024/1024 = 931.3225
以本人電腦上的硬盤為例:

我的系統盤是一塊固態硬盤,而D, E盤是一塊1T大小的機械硬盤,但實際大小只有465G * 2 = 930G
這也與上面計算相吻合。
事實上現在有一種更為准確的換算:
1KiB=1024Byte
1KB=1000Byte
KiB是kilo binary byte的縮寫,是指2的10次方,而KB是kilobyte的縮寫,指的是千字節。
KiB , GiB 在給Linux系統分區的時候常常可以看到,這種換算更為准確 。
Linux系統嚴格區分了這兩種換算方法!!!!!!!
補充:內存條的換算與硬盤不一樣,在內存條中1MB=1024KB,這個商家沒有偷工減料。
